3. Build a Tangible Career Map
A career in fashion isn’t just about creativity—it’s about navigation. Create a visual or written plan of where you’d like to be in 1, 3, and 5 years. Include internships, certifications, portfolio milestones, and collaborations you aspire to.
This approach turns ambiguity into achievement. These are your career roadmap tips—signposts on the journey to your ultimate goal. They provide direction, accountability, and a clear sense of progression.
4. Prioritize Skill Development
A designer’s toolkit isn’t just filled with scissors and sketchpads. It’s packed with skills—from technical prowess to creative agility. Make it a goal to level up your draping technique, pattern drafting, digital illustration, or even marketing.
Enroll in masterclasses. Follow industry mentors. Experiment beyond your comfort zone. To set fashion goals effectively, your foundation must be solid and ever-expanding.
